Notice Title
Supply of Remote Telemetry Units (RTUs)
Notice Description
Scottish Water (SW) is looking for Remote Telemetry Units (RTUs) suppliers. The scope of the framework will include but will not be limited to the design, supply of RTUs and associated components, training, technical and development support. The telemetry master station (TMS) is provided by Emerson and is Open Enterprise (OE) with specific SW variants. The TMS has been installed to meet SW requirements. The RTU manufacturer has to have certification issued by Emerson confirming their device is suitable for operation with SW TMS. The RTU device has to be capable of communicating with the TMS version 2.52 up to and including version 3.36. It's anticipated that the TMS might change within the life of the framework and the requirement for RTU supply will be re-procured based on the TMS change.
